How Turn Off Cloud Actually Works
Turning off cloud functions typically means limiting or disabling automatic data syncing across devices. Most cloud platforms offer settings that allow users to disable sync for specific folders or apps, manually uninstall cloud apps, or adjust privacy options to restrict data collection. It’s a straightforward process focused on control—not deletion—minimizing ongoing uploads and preserving on-device storage. Understanding these steps allows users to configure services aligned with personal privacy and financial goals without disrupting daily access.

*Is Turning Off Cloud Safe?
Yes. Disabling cloud sync reduces automatic data transfers, lowering exposure and potential vulnerabilities. It’s a simple privacy safeguard, not a security risk.
*Does Turning It Off Delete My Data?
No. Local copies remain unless manually removed. Only shared or synced data is affected.
*Can I Still Access My Files Without the Cloud?
Yes. Files remain stored locally or on your device. Access is unchanged—only sync behavior is disabled.

Benefits include lower monthly fees, reduced data usage, and stronger privacy. However, users should note potential trade-offs: limited cross-device access, manual sync requirements, and possible loss of cloud-based collaboration tools. Realistic expectations help avoid disappointment—turning off cloud is about optimization, not cutting off digital connection
